The devil wants you to believe the lie that you are unworthy so he can keep you enslaved to sin and hopelessness. We often beat ourselves up about our behavior and our sins. We feel burdened by the guilt and condemnation that we lay on ourselves! It could be that you are basing your belief about God’s forgiveness on your feelings rather than on God’s word. Our emotions can’t discern the truth from lies. They just respond to what we think. It’s dangerous to base truth on how we “feel.” Feelings come and go, but God’s Word never changes.

 

God’s mercy and grace will enable you to turn from the sinful lifestyle that once held you captive. As you believe this more deeply and renovate your mind, you will be set free from self-condemnation. Just believe in God.

 

The only way to truly know you are forgiven is to believe God’s Word. God has forgiven you based on what Christ did, not on what you do. Jesus Christ was the perfect God/Man who died so that we might be fully and completely forgiven of all our sins (past, present and future). Jesus died for the sins of the whole world. Not one sin was left out (except the sin of rejecting Him).

 

When you trust in who Christ is and what He did, you receive the forgiveness His sacrifice provided. Apart from God’s full forgiveness, we could not have a relationship with Him and He could not live in us. Everyone in Christ lives in a forgiven state with God, 24/7. The Biblical word for this is justified, which means God relates to us “just-if-I’d” never sinned.

 

One reason we question God’s forgiveness is that we believe God has only forgiven our past sins and not our future sins. We mistakenly think that any new sins that we commit separate us from God once again.

 

When we receive Christ into our life, our forgiveness is a settled issue once and for all. The issue now is not forgiveness but understanding how Christ’s life within us can set us free from sin’s destructive power.

 

So, go ahead and receive it! Agree with God and thank Him for His complete forgiveness. This is where freedom begins. You either believe God that you are forgiven or you are saying that Christ’s death on the cross was not sufficient to pay for your sins!

To obtain truth, we need 4 Rs:

1. Revelation (new enlightenment or understanding of Truth)

2. Renovate (trash the lie(s); study and meditate on Truth)

3. Rely (rest in and live out of the Truth)

4. Resist (resist the devil and stand firm in the Truth)

 

We all need revelation of God to know him better. We need an eye-opening experience, a revelation, to see the things of God that we cannot possibly see with our physical eyes. God wants to give us his revelation. He has poured it out in his scripture. He has made it clear that he wants us to have it. So if we want more revelation, we have to ask for it. He is faithful. When we ask, he provides every time. 

 

Renovate, defined in the dictionary is to make new, or renew. Renovating your mind takes time, takes commitment, and takes courage. It is choosing something different than what everyone else is choosing. In the battle of renewing your mind in God’s word, you will be met with resistance. 

 

When the enemy comes behind you and the enemy tries to steal, kill, and destroy you, he will make you look at your blemished past. Don’t. Rely on God and look forward. Stop looking at your flaws. Stop looking at your past. You have been bought with a price. Jesus Christ took all your flaws and that alone makes you worthy. Rely on God.

 

Do you need to resist the enemy? Is there a place right now where the enemy is involved in your life and you know it? Put up your barriers. When you know what you have in Christ and you know who you are in him, you will begin to put up barriers against the enemy. 

 

Even when you are relying on God, when you are renewing your mind, when you are resisting the enemy, you will still meet with other resistance. It can be something like a desire to not work, not push forward. Just starting to get into the word of God breaks the resistance. It is going to set you free. There is freedom where the truth is.
